How to fill out the Paragraph Of The Week online

This guide provides step-by-step instructions on how to fill out the Paragraph Of The Week form effectively. Follow the outlined steps to ensure that your paragraph writing process is clear and organized.

Follow the steps to complete the Paragraph Of The Week form:

  1. Click ‘Get Form’ button to obtain the form and open it for editing.
  2. Begin with the title section where you will enter your name and date. Ensure that this information is accurate, as it helps in identifying your submission.
  3. Move on to the brainstorming section for Monday. Reflect on the question posed: "What would happen if animals could talk?" Write down your thoughts and ideas in the provided space. Take your time to think critically about the implications of this scenario.
  4. On Tuesday, proceed to write the main body sentences. Select three details from your brainstorm that support your topic and write complete sentences for each. Include an explanation sentence for every detail, elaborating on why it is significant.
  5. For Wednesday, write your topic sentence and closing sentence. The topic sentence should outline the main idea without revealing specific details, while the closing sentence should summarize your thoughts using different words.
  6. On Thursday, compile all your work by integrating the topic sentence, detail sentences, and closing sentence into a coherent paragraph. Carefully review your writing to ensure clarity and completeness.

Paragraph of the Week is a systematic, scaffolded approach to teaching paragraph writing. By breaking down the writing process into sequential, easy to follow steps, and following a consistent weekly routine, writing becomes a non-threatening task.

Here are the basic type: Descriptive paragraphs. Narrative paragraphs. Expository paragraphs. Persuasive paragraphs. Literary paragraph.

A good paragraph is composed of a topic sentence (or key sentence), relevant supporting sentences, and a closing (or transition) sentence. This structure is key to keeping your paragraph focused on the main idea and creating a clear and concise image.

PARAGRAPH STRUCTURE Most paragraphs in an essay have a three-part structure—introduction, body, and conclusion.

Examples Paragraph. The illustration (examples) paragraph is useful when we want to explain or clarify something, such as an object, a person, a concept, or a situation. When we illustrate, we show how something is as we point out.

How Many Paragraphs Is 150 Words? 150 words is about 0.75-1.5 paragraphs for essays or 1-3 for easier reading (to allow skimming). A paragraph length typically has 100-200 words and 5-6 sentences.
